Ingredients Breakdown & Substitutions

To get that signature creamy-fudgy combo, each ingredient plays a crucial role. Here’s what you’ll need and what you can swap if needed:

Base Brownie Layer

  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ter  Adds richness and moisture.
    Swap: Coconut oil for a dairy-free version.
  • 1 cup granulated sugar  Sweetens and helps create that shiny crust.
    Swap: Coconut sugar for a deeper flavor.
  • 2 large eggs  bind everything together and add structure.
    Swap: Flax eggs for vegan option (1 tbsp flaxseed + 3 tbsp water per egg).
  • 1/3 cup unsweetened cocoa powder  For that deep chocolate flavor.
    Tip: Use Dutch-process for a smoother taste.
  • 1/2 cup all-purpose flour  The structure builder.
    Swap: Almond flour for gluten-free.
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ract  Enhances the chocolate and adds warmth.

Mousse Topping

  • 1 cup heavy whipping cream  Makes the mousse airy and smooth.
    Swap: Coconut cream for a dairy-free version.
  • 1/2 cup semisweet chocolate chips  Melted into the mousse for deep flavor.
  • 2 tbsp powdered sugar  Light sweetness and stability for the whipped cream.
  • 1 tsp gelatin (optional)  For firmer mousse.
    Tip: Omit if you like a softer texture.

Step-by-Step Instructions with Expert Tips

Step 1: Preheat & Prep

Preheat your oven to 325°F (163°C).
Line an 8×8 inch baking pan with parchment paper.

Step 2: Make the Brownie Batter

  1. Melt the butter in a saucepan, then remove from heat.
  2. Whisk in sugar, cocoa powder, and vanilla until smooth.
  3. Add eggs one at a time, beating well after each.
  4. Fold in flour gently until just combined.
    Pro tip: Don’t overmix this keeps the brownies fudgy!

Step 3: Bake the Brownie Layer

Pour batter into the pan and smooth the top.
Bake for 2225 minutes, or until a toothpick comes out with a few moist crumbs.
Let it cool completely before adding mousse.

Step 4: Prepare the Chocolate Mousse

  1. Melt chocolate chips in the microwave or over a double boiler.
  2. In a bowl, whip the cream with powdered sugar until soft peaks form.
  3. Gently fold in melted chocolate (cooled to room temp).
    Optional: Add dissolved gelatin now for a firmer mousse.

Step 5: Assemble

Spread the mousse evenly over the cooled brownie layer.
Chill for 23 hours until set.

Step 6: Slice & Serve Chocolate Mousse Brownies

Use a sharp knife dipped in hot water to slice cleanly.
Top with shaved chocolate or berries if desired!

Storage, Make-Ahead & Freezing Tips

  • Fridge: Store in an airtight container for up to 5 days.
  • Freezer: Freeze slices individually wrapped in plastic + foil. Lasts up to 2 months.
  • Reheating: Serve chilled or let sit at room temp for 10 minutes.
  • Leftover ideas: Crumble into ice cream or layer in parfaits with fruit and whipped cream.

Creative Variations & Serving Ideas

  • Mocha Mousse Brownies  Add 1 tsp espresso powder to brownie base.
  • Berry Swirl Mousse  Swirl in raspberry purée before chilling.
  • Coconut-Chocolate Fusion  Use coconut cream and sprinkle toasted coconut on top.
  • Peanut Butter Mousse Brownies  Fold peanut butter into the whipped cream for a nutty twist.
  • Pair With: A bold red wine or a glass of milk. For kids’ parties, pair with hot cocoa.

Expert Tips for Success

  • Use room temperature eggs  This helps the batter emulsify smoothly.
  • Cool chocolate before folding into mousse  Prevents cream from melting.
  • Using parchment paper  Makes it easier to lift and cut clean slices.
  • Always chill before slicing. Gives the mousse time to set properly.
  • Avoid overbaking. Brownies keep cooking even after removal; pull them when the center is slightly underdone.

FAQs

1. Can I make these Chocolate Mousse Brownies ahead of time?


Absolutely! They actually taste better the next day. Make a batch the night before and store in the fridge for a ready-to-go treat.

2. Can I freeze Chocolate Mousse Brownies?


Yes! Freeze in layers with parchment paper between slices. Thaw in the fridge overnight before serving.

3. How can I make them gluten-free or dairy-free?


Swap all-purpose flour with almond flour, and use coconut oil + coconut cream instead of dairy. Still delicious!
